DIY Magazine
Opinion: Fantastic

Though he might be best known for his acting, that's by no means the only string Joe Keery has to his bow. A former member of psych-rockers Post Animal, the multi-hyphenate has been releasing music under the moniker Djo for years, notching up two synthy, electronic-led albums (2019's 'Twenty Twenty' and 2022's 'DECIDE') and one very viral song (the TikTok hit 'End Of Beginning'). His third solo outing, however, is something altogether more full-bodied - an ambitious, joyous, heartfelt collection that finds him revelling in analogue instrumentation, expansive arrangements, and unashamedly retro sonic touchstones.
